Report the Motorcycle Accident to Davie Law Enforcement
Under Section 316.066(1) of the Florida Statutes, a motor vehicle crash resulting in death, personal injury, or significant property damage must be reported to law enforcement. Within ten days from the date of the incident, the law enforcement officer assigned for the investigation of the incident shall prepare a Florida Traffic Crash Report identifying the following pertinent details:
- The date, time, and location of the crash
- A description of the vehicles involved
- The names and addresses of the parties involved, including all drivers and passengers, and the vehicle identification in which each was a driver or a passenger
- The names and addresses of witnesses
- The name, badge number, and law enforcement agency of the officer investigating the crash
- The names of the insurance companies for the respective parties involved in the crash
The accident report is crucial evidence to support your claim for damages. Your attorney can use the information in this report to build the most substantial possible claim on your behalf.
Seek Immediate Medical Treatment from Your Motorcycle Accident
Before anything else, it is essential to treat your injuries. While under medical attention, make sure that you gather possible documentation related to the injuries you sustained. A medical report identifying the extent of your injuries may determine the value of your legal claim.
Gather Evidence from the Davie Motorcycle Accident
Aside from the police and medical reports, you may gather other evidence, such as photos, videos, and witness statements, to determine the party at fault. While Florida is a no-fault state, the no-fault provisions for motor vehicle accidents do not apply to motorcycle accidents.
File a Claim Against the At-Fault Driver’s Insurance in Davie
As a rule, Florida is a no-fault state. Claims for injuries sustained due to motor accidents shall be filed with the party’s insurance company even if the other party’s at fault. However, the rule does not apply in motorcycle accidents. The injured party of a motorcycle crash may file a claim against the at-fault driver’s insurance.
File a Personal Injury Claim in Court for Your Davie Motorcycle Accident
If the at-fault driver’s insurance refuses to pay or the at-fault driver’s liability is questioned, you may file a personal injury lawsuit in court. After filing the complaint, the parties may avail of various modes of discovery to elicit additional evidence or admissions from the other party.
After that, the case undergoes a mediation process to open discussions for possible settlement of the case. If the parties cannot reach an amicable settlement, the case proceeds to trial.
Statute of Limitations in a Davie Motorcycle Accident Case
The Florida statute of limitations for a motorcycle accident is two years from the date of the accident. It is not advisable to wait that long to take action. Instead, contact a Davie motorcycle accident attorney as soon as possible after your accident to recover the damages owed to you. The key here is that the longer you wait to get legal help, the harder it is to find the necessary witnesses and other evidence to support your claim.
There are some situations where this limitation is shorter. If a motorcycle accident victim dies as a result of the accident, the family can only take legal action in a court of law for two years.
If you wait beyond the statute of limitations, the court cannot force the at-fault party to pay for your losses. It will not likely hear your case.
What Kinds of Compensation Can You Recover?
After a motorcycle accident in Davie, Florida, your first objective is to prove the other party was negligent. If you can show that they are responsible for your losses, you can then seek compensation for any losses you have directly related to the actions of that party. Examples of recoverable damages include:
- Medical bills associated with the accident include bills for care to stabilize your health, hospital stays, medications, specialist care, surgeries, and future medical bills in these areas.
- Ongoing healthcare costs, including care for rehabilitation and recovery, as well as ongoing care you may need due to permanent loss, such as in-home support.
- Property damage, including replacement or repair of your motorcycle or other personal assets
- Lost wages if you were unable to go to work for a period of time due to your injuries. In situations where your injuries are ongoing, loss of earning capacity may also apply.
- Pain and suffering, which refers to any physical or psychological pain or suffering you have due to the accident and its impact on your health and well-being
- Emotional trauma and mental anguish, including the onset of conditions such as post-traumatic stress disorder or depression

Common Causes of Motorcycle Accidents in Davie
Motorcycle accidents in Davie happen due to negligence, bias against riders, and reckless operation of a vehicle. Some of the most common causes of motorcycle accidents include:
- Distracted drivers not paying attention to roadways
- Intersection accidents due to other drivers failing to yield the right of way
- Impairment of the driver due to alcohol, drugs, or prescription medications with side effects
- Motorcycle mechanical failures and defective components
- Poor road conditions due to debris on the roadways
- Reckless driving, such as speeding, illegal lane changes, tailgating, or failing to signal
- Weather conditions that make it unsafe to operate on the roadway
- Fatigued drivers, especially in situations of commercial trucks or vehicles
